But as far as telling whether your timing belt is still good or not, just do a visual inspection on your own. Just look out for any signs of wear or tear, take the valve cover off. Then by slowing turning your crankshaft bolt, do a visual inspection. Also check the tension, the belt shouldn't have much of a gap of tension when pressing on it.
